纤维素酶纯化方法与原生质体的制备

摘    要:以绿色木霉为材料,经稻草粉固体发酵、浸提得纤维素酶粗酶液,然后经硫酸铵分级沉淀,超滤,SephadexG-75柱层析3种方法纯化,利用得到的纤维素酶,分别制备幼嫩番茄叶片的原生质体。结果发现高度纯化的纤维素酶几乎得不到原生质体,而经超滤后的纤维素酶制备原生质体效果最佳。

关 键 词:纤维素酶  原生质体  番茄叶片

Methods of Purification of Cellulase and Preparation of Protoplasts

Abstract:Trichoderma viride was used as the material in this experiment,cellulase was produced by solid state fermentation with the straw powder and crude cellulase was gotten by immertion,then by three different treatments -(NH4)2SO4 classified precipitate,ultrafilter and Sephadex G-75 chromatography. Three different treatments were done separately for the preparation of protoplasts of the young tomato leaves and the results were that the high purified cellulase got less protoplasts and cellulase by the ultrafilter had the best effect.
Keywords:Cellulose  Protoplasts  Young tomato leaf
